Rubber Mallets

Rubber Mallet Types:

It’s important to recognize the different types available to suit your specific needs. The most common types are standard rubber mallets and dead blow mallets. Standard rubber mallets are versatile ideal for general use such as assembling furniture, laying tiles or light demolition work. Dead blow mallets contain a hollow head filled with steel shot or sand which minimizes rebound and delivers a more controlled impact. This type is particularly useful for precision work where controlled force is necessary such as in automotive repairs or fine woodworking.

Handle Material and Durability:

The handle material of a rubber mallet significantly impacts its durability and user comfort. Wooden handles are traditional and provide a good grip but they can splinter or break under heavy use. Fiberglass handles offer a great balance of strength and lightness being both durable and shock absorbent. Metal handles often encased in a rubber or plastic grip are the most robust but can be heavier and less comfortable for extended use. Choosing a handle material that suits your specific applications and comfort preferences is essential for prolonged use and efficiency.

Weight and Size Considerations:

The weight and size of the rubber mallet are crucial factors that affect its performance. Heavier mallets provide more force and are ideal for tasks that require significant impact such as driving stakes or breaking up materials. However, they can be tiring to use over long periods. Lighter mallets on the other hand offer better control and are suitable for delicate tasks where precision is key. It’s important to match the weight and size of the mallet to the specific tasks you intend to perform to ensure effective and efficient use.

Ergonomic Design and Grip:

Ergonomics play a significant role in the comfort and usability of a rubber mallet. A well designed mallet should have a balanced weight distribution and a handle that fits comfortably in your hand. Look for handles with non slip grips which provide better control and reduce the risk of the mallet slipping during use. Rubber or textured handles can enhance grip security making the mallet easier to handle especially during prolonged tasks. Ensuring the mallet is comfortable to hold and use will help prevent hand fatigue and increase your work efficiency.

Application-Specific Features:

Certain features can enhance the functionality of a rubber mallet for specific applications. For example some mallets have replaceable heads allowing you to switch out worn or damaged heads without replacing the entire tool. Others may feature dual heads with varying hardness levels for greater versatility. These features can be particularly useful if you perform a variety of tasks requiring different levels of impact. Identifying the features that align with your work can improve the mallet’s effectiveness and extend its lifespan.

UNVEILING THE pros AND conS

Rubber Mallets

pros

  • One of the primary advantages of rubber mallets is their ability to deliver force without damaging the surface of the material being worked on. This makes them ideal for tasks that involve delicate or finished surfaces such as installing tile, working with softwood or assembling furniture. The rubber head ensures that even forceful blows don’t leave dents, scratches or marks.
  • Rubber mallets provide a controlled impact which is particularly useful in precision work. For example when fitting pieces together in woodworking or adjusting components in metalwork the softer head of a rubber mallet allows for incremental adjustments without the risk of over hitting or causing misalignment.
  • Dead blow rubber mallets which contain sand or steel shot inside the head offer the advantage of reduced rebound. This means that the energy from the strike is absorbed within the mallet allowing for more precise and effective blows. This feature is beneficial in automotive work, machinery maintenance and other tasks where controlled force is crucial.
  • Rubber mallets are versatile tools used in a wide range of applications. From DIY home improvement projects to professional construction and automotive repairs their gentle yet effective striking capability makes them suitable for numerous tasks. They are especially useful for jobs that require assembling or adjusting parts without causing damage.
  • Modern rubber mallets are often designed with ergonomics in mind featuring comfortable handles and balanced weight distribution. This reduces hand fatigue and allows for extended use without discomfort which is important in both professional and DIY settings where long periods of tool use are common.

cons

  • While the gentle impact of a rubber mallet is an advantage for delicate tasks, it can be a disadvantage for jobs that require significant force. For heavy duty applications such as breaking concrete or driving large stakes a metal hammer would be more effective. The softer head of a rubber mallet simply doesn’t provide the necessary impact for such tasks.
  • Over time the rubber head of a mallet can wear down especially with heavy use. This can reduce the effectiveness of the tool and may require replacement. While some rubber mallets have replaceable heads those that don’t can become less useful as the head deteriorates.
  • Rubber mallets are not as effective on hard materials like metal or concrete where more force and a harder striking surface are needed. For these materials a traditional metal hammer is usually a better choice as it can deliver the necessary impact without the risk of breaking.
  • The rubber head of a mallet can sometimes slip off smooth surfaces especially if they are wet or greasy. This can reduce control and effectiveness particularly in situations where precise strikes are necessary. In contrast a metal hammer’s harder surface can grip better providing more reliable contact.
  • While lighter rubber mallets are easier to handle for delicate tasks they may not provide the necessary momentum for more forceful applications. Heavier rubber mallets can be cumbersome and cause fatigue reducing their practicality for extended use in larger projects.
